分享好友 数智知识首页 数智知识分类 切换频道

探索进销存系统的核心数据存储位置

进销存系统,即进货、销售和库存管理系统,是企业日常运营中不可或缺的工具。它的核心数据存储位置对于系统的高效运行至关重要。以下是对进销存系统核心数据存储位置的探讨。...
2025-07-03 15:2990

进销存系统,即进货、销售和库存管理系统,是企业日常运营中不可或缺的工具。它的核心数据存储位置对于系统的高效运行至关重要。以下是对进销存系统核心数据存储位置的探讨:

一、数据库存储

1. 关系型数据库

  • 关系型数据库如MySQL、Oracle等,以其结构化的数据模型和事务处理能力,成为进销存系统的首选存储方式。它们支持复杂的查询操作,如联表查询、子查询等,能够有效地处理进销存系统中的各种业务逻辑。
  • 关系型数据库通过建立表之间的关联,实现了数据的完整性和一致性。例如,在销售订单表中记录了客户信息、产品信息、销售数量等字段,而库存表中则记录了产品的库存量、入库时间等信息。通过这些关联,可以确保数据的一致性和准确性。

2. 非关系型数据库

  • 非关系型数据库如MongoDB、Redis等,以其灵活的数据结构和高并发访问能力,在某些特定场景下也可用于进销存系统的存储。
  • 非关系型数据库通常采用键值对或文档的形式存储数据,这使得它们在处理大量数据时更加高效。例如,在库存管理中,可以使用Redis作为缓存来存储实时库存信息,提高查询速度。

二、文件存储

1. CSV文件

  • CSV文件是一种常用的文本文件格式,用于存储进销存系统中的原始数据。它以逗号为分隔符,将数据分割成多行,每行包含一个记录。这种格式简单易用,但不支持复杂的查询和计算功能。
  • CSV文件适用于存储简单的进销存数据,如商品名称、价格、库存数量等。在实际应用中,可以通过编写脚本将这些数据导入到进销存系统中。

2. Excel文件

  • Excel文件是一种常见的电子表格软件,用于存储进销存系统中的数据。它支持多种数据类型,如数字、文本、日期等,并提供了丰富的图表和公式功能。
  • Excel文件适用于存储较为复杂的进销存数据,如销售报表、库存报表等。在实际应用中,可以通过Excel软件将这些数据导入到进销存系统中,并进行相应的数据处理和分析。

探索进销存系统的核心数据存储位置

三、云存储服务

1. 对象存储

  • 对象存储如Amazon S3、阿里云OSS等,提供了一种基于对象的存储方式。它允许用户以文件的形式存储大量的二进制数据,并通过URL进行访问和管理。
  • 对象存储适用于存储大量的进销存数据,如图片、视频、日志文件等。在实际应用中,可以通过编写脚本将这些数据上传到对象存储中,并使用URL进行访问和下载。

2. 文件存储网关

  • 文件存储网关如Filesink、DynamoDB Files等,可以将本地文件存储与云端服务相结合。它允许用户将本地文件上传到云端,并在需要时从云端下载这些文件。
  • 文件存储网关适用于实现跨平台的文件共享和协作。在实际应用中,可以通过文件存储网关将本地文件上传到云端,并与团队成员共享;同时,也可以从云端下载这些文件,以便进行进一步的处理和分析。

四、混合存储策略

1. 结合关系型数据库和非关系型数据库

  • 在进销存系统中,可以结合使用关系型数据库和非关系型数据库来存储不同类型的数据。例如,使用关系型数据库存储结构化的数据(如客户信息、产品信息等),使用非关系型数据库存储半结构化或非结构化的数据(如订单详情、库存变动记录等)。
  • 这种混合存储策略可以提高数据的可读性和可维护性,同时也可以利用不同数据库的优势来处理不同的业务需求。

2. 分层存储

  • 根据数据的重要性和使用频率,可以将数据分为不同的层级进行存储。例如,将经常访问的热点数据存储在内存中(如Redis缓存),将低频访问的冷数据存储在磁盘上(如关系型数据库)。
  • 这种分层存储策略可以提高系统的响应速度和资源利用率,同时也可以根据实际需求动态调整数据的存储位置。

综上所述,进销存系统的核心数据存储位置是一个复杂而重要的问题。选择合适的存储方式不仅关系到系统的性能和稳定性,还影响到后续的数据分析和决策制定。因此,企业在选择进销存系统时,应充分考虑自身业务需求和技术条件,选择最适合的存储方案。

举报
收藏 0
推荐产品更多
蓝凌MK

办公自动化130条点评

4.5星

简道云

低代码开发平台0条点评

4.5星

帆软FineBI

商业智能软件0条点评

4.5星

纷享销客CRM

客户管理系统0条点评

4.5星

推荐知识更多